Job description
ARM Capital Partners, a wholly-owned subsidiary of Asset & Resource Management Company (ARM) Limited, is an institutional manager of PE funds. Currently, the Company is advising ARM PE Fund, a mid-market private equity fund, pursuing growth and expansion opportunities in Nigeria and, to a lesser extent, the rest of West Africa. ARM is recruiting on behalf of its Investee Company; Boulos Food and Beverages for a Cost Accountant.
Boulos Food and Beverages(“BFB”) is a food and beverage manufacturing firm based in Ibadan, Nigeria. BFB manufactures and markets branded non-alcoholic drinks, evaporated milk and tomato paste products for the Nigerian market. The company is based in Ibadan, Oyo State.
Job Summary
• To maintain effective costing system across all the company’s supply chain process
• To act as the costing expert and keeper of costing system for the organization
• To provide timely, accurate and complete product costing for management account
• Develop and enhance the cost accounting processes across the organization
• Identify cost reduction opportunity for the organization
• Documentation of cost accounting and inventory processes and procedures across the factories of the organization.
Reporting Relationships
• Reports directly to the Head of Finance
• Interact with the commercial team
• Interact with the factory team and other supply chain team
Principal Accountabilities:
I. Maintain accurate and timely costing across all aspects of the production process and ensure that these consistently reflect the true picture. Ensure cost data is allocated correctly and take corrective action to resolve issues
II. Ensure that the Bill of Materials reflect correct usage levels and support investigations of any major variances with a view to resolution
III. Ensure that the material costs give an accurate picture of current costs, taking into account stock levels on hand
IV. Coordinate and ensure effective month end close activities for both manufacturing and other supply chain activities
V. Effective analysis of material price variance between the budget and actual
VI. Review current cost accounting processes/ controls and continuously seek to enhance the same
VII. Document cost accounting and inventory processes/ procedures
VIII. Prepare relevant and actionable monthly reports

Qualifications:
• Accounting or Finance Graduate ;
• Qualified Accountant (ICAN, ACCA) with 5-7 years relevant experience;
• Advanced computer skills specifically in Microsoft Excel and ERP Systems.
Technical/Professional Experience:
• FMCG manufacturing experience required
• Costing and stock accounting experience required
• High volume multiple production environment with a proven track record of getting results
• Must have strong analytical skills with particular attention to detail
• Be self-motivated and self-directed, able and willing to take initiative
• Have considerable interaction and involvement with all levels in other departments
• Have an ability to work independently with attention to detail and the ability to work on multiple projects at a time is essential
• Must be able to respond to changing circumstances.
